Origin
The name 'Sephiroth' originates from the Hebrew language, where it is the plural of 'sephirah,' meaning 'sphere' or 'emanation.' In Jewish mysticism, particularly Kabbalah, the Sephiroth are the ten attributes through which the Infinite reveals itself. The term has been adopted into popular culture largely through the character Sephiroth in the video game Final Fantasy VII, where it is used as a distinctive character name.
